Administrative & Social Media Assistant

Posted 2 days ago

This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in Latin America.

📋 Description

• Provide comprehensive administrative assistance to the organization.

• Schedule and organize meetings, training sessions, and various activities.

• Set up Zoom meetings and disseminate links and pertinent information to participants.

• Coordinate communications with participants, partners, and community members.

• Manage WhatsApp groups and other communication platforms.

• Assist in programs, events, and training sessions.

• Keep schedules, tasks, and organizational activities well-organized and on track.

• Handle administrative responsibilities for the founder to enable her focus on fundraising and organizational development.

• Schedule social media posts utilizing organizational scheduling tools.

• Prepare and organize content in alignment with the posting schedule.

• Understand how content is presented on platforms like LinkedIn.

• Provide basic social media coordination and organization support.

• Adhere to existing content and posting guidelines.

• Collaborate closely with the founder to grasp priorities and upcoming requirements.

• Recognize administrative tasks that can be managed independently.

• Maintain clear communication and ensure follow-through on assigned tasks.

• Adjust responsibilities as the organization expands and additional support becomes necessary.


⛳️ Requirements

• Minimum of 1 year of experience as an administrative assistant, virtual assistant, coordinator, or in a comparable role.

• Practical experience in social media management or scheduling.

• Basic understanding of how posts are displayed on platforms like LinkedIn.

• Experience in scheduling meetings and utilizing tools such as Zoom.

• Strong organizational and time-management abilities.

• Excellent written and verbal communication skills.

• Capability to work independently while accepting direction and feedback.

• Proactive, reliable, and detail-oriented.

• Comfortable operating in a flexible, dynamic nonprofit environment.

• English proficiency at C1 level or equivalent professional standard.


🏝️ Benefits

• Opportunities for remote work.

• Part-time schedule of 10 hours per week.

• Contract facilitated through a payroll platform.

• Chance to collaborate with a mission-driven nonprofit organization.

• Flexible and evolving work environment.
